    CAC sticker did it. Not too many recently sold in that grade with the sticker, and some people may not be able to submit themselves. Plus, with CAC starting their own registry, there's even more reason for some people to pay (overpay?) for certain coins.

    There's actually no way to really tell if it did sell for that much. There's a thing on ebay called "shill bidding". They could have had a friend or relative place a huge bid on it just to inflate the price. I've been buying on ebay since the early 2000's and I've seen everything going on there. In some cases, the seller relists it a week or two later, adding in the description that it's being relisted because the last winner backed out or something to that extent, but then the new starting price is a hair over what the last bidder won it for.
